Transaction 58fbb76710ab4ed6280b4debb0dbfde47a676be879e028b09ff31e6c46ff0381

1 Input
2 Outputs
  • 58fbb76710ab4ed6280b4debb0dbfde47a676be879e028b09ff31e6c46ff0381:0
  • value  3000000000
    address  393pPtALuFyff1227jZtv6p931qqFWogTq
  • 58fbb76710ab4ed6280b4debb0dbfde47a676be879e028b09ff31e6c46ff0381:1
  • value  2489916416
    address  3GM7CFCwDuqTYAjDHY5gkuq1ov9RMpL33Q